Plants that do not require pollination or other stimulation to produce parthenocarpic fruit have vegetative parthenocarpy.

Varieties of the pineapple, banana, cucumber, grape, orange, grapefruit, persimmon, and breadfruit are the examples

Answer:

They are the natural or artificially induced production of fruit without fertilization of ovules, which makes the fruit seedless. Examples: pineapple, figs etc. (these are the examples of naturally occurring parthenocarpic fruits)
